Children’s Hospital Astronomy Outreach

UCSF Children’s Hospital Collaborators Space in Medicine UAS UCSF Children’s Hospital Planetary Society

Our Goals Design a curriculum adapted for children at local hospitals. Offer creative and fun space education lessons for children at the hospital.

Lesson plan ideas Google contract with Planetary Society Google VR cardboard glasses Titans of Space VR app Google has generously offered to donate their google cardboard VR glasses to our project. Titans of space is an android app that gives tour of space

Fun physics labs Guest speakers How do telescopes work? How to make one? Astrophotography lab Low-cost lesson plans adapted for children at hospital Guest speakers Astronauts Aeronautical engineers

Personalized book Currently working with a publishing company that writes personalized books about space for children.

Current Plans Working with UCSF Child Life Program Science summer camp 2-3 volunteers in each session 1-2 sessions/month Rotate volunteers for each session Program will continue into the academic year
